In this paper we study the topology of the hyperbolic component of the parameter plane for the Newton's method applied to n-th degree Bring-Jerrard polynomials given by P_n(z) = z^n-cz 1, \ c. For n=5, using the Tschirnhaus-Bring-Jerrard nonlinear transformations, this family controls, at least theoretically, the roots of all quintic polynomials. We also study a bifurcation cascade of the bifurcation locus by considering c . |
